Garden maintenance is an necessary practice for keeping outside spaces healthy, lively, and welcoming thro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not only improves a residential or commercial property's visual appeal however also makes sure the longevity of its plants and functions. Upkeep includes routine jobs such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By resolving these needs consistently, gardeners can avoid bug invasions, control disease spread, and maintain a well balanced environment where plants prosper. Seasonal factors to consider, such as mulching in the spring or securing fragile plants in winter season, are also important to sustaining garden vigor. Beyond visual appeals, correct garden maintenance pl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Getting rid of unhealthy or damaged foliage assists prevent pathogens from spreading, while strategic pruning encourages brand-new development and flowering.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and organic matter replenishment-- offers the nutrients plants need to flourish. Furthermore, the thoughtful integration of companion planting and pollinator-friendly types can enhance garden resilience while adding to local communities. A structured upkeep schedule assists house owners prepare for continuous requirements and prevent expensive overhauls later on. This schedule typically consists of monthly evaluations,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as needed. Whether for ornamental flower beds, veggie plots, or mixed-use landscapes, consistent care makes sure that the garden stays a source of enjoyment and charm all year long
